Owner of Osteria Delbianco Planning to Open New Restaurant

Dorjan Kalaja, owner of Midtown’s Osteria Delbianco, is looking to open a new restaurant, Delbianco Prime, at 423 Madison Avenue around the corner from his flagship.

Kalaja says it is still in the very early planning stages, so he does not have any details to share. He says it may open next year, but he cannot confirm when its grand opening will be. The company behind the restaurant was established this March, and the restaurant’s liquor license is pending. 

His flagship, Osteria Delbianco, is an upscale Italian eatery that serves Northern Italian cuisine, also offering a weekend brunch. Its chef Diego Bigucci is from Riccione, a town on Italy’s Adriatic coast in the Emilia-Romagna region in the north of the country. Its menu includes but is not limited to antipasto like caprese di bufala and prosciutto con burrata, salads like caesar, soups like pasta e fagioli, pastas that are made in-house daily like tagliatelle al ragu and risotto ai funghi, and main courses like grilled salmon. It also has a robust wine list.
